MINNEAPOLIS (WCCO) — Flood warnings have been issued for a few areas surrounding Minnesota rivers.
The National Weather Service issued warnings for the Redwood River, near Redwood Falls, Cottonwood River at New Ulm and the South Fork Crow River.
At 10 a.m. Thursday, the stage of the Cottonwood River was 6.6 feet. Major flooding is expected with a flood stage of 11 feet.
Flood watches have also been issued for the Crow River, and the Minnesota River at Mankato, at Henderson and near Jordan.
All watches and warnings are in effect until further notice.
